Abstract
The present invention relates to methods and apparatuses for controlling cell configuration in a cellular network, wherein a cell identity and a local cell spectrum resource entity or profile are assigned to an access device in response to a result of sensing a local radio environment at said access device to detect possible neighbor cells. The assigned local cell spectrum resource entity or profile is used to allocate cell spectrum resource from a shared multi-operator spectrum to said access device.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 - 18 . (canceled)
19 . An apparatus, comprising:
one or more processors; one or more memories including computer program code, the one or more memories and the computer program code configured to, with the one or more processors, cause the apparatus to perform at least the following:
sensing a local radio environment of an access device to detect possible neighbor cells; and
controlling assignment of a cell identity and at least one of a plurality of local cell spectrum resource entities or profiles to said access device in response to the sensing result.
20 . The apparatus according to claim 19 , wherein said sensing is controlled by said cellular network.
21 . The apparatus according to claim 20 , wherein said sensing is initiated from a central control entity of said cellular network in response to an establishment of a connection of said apparatus to said central control entity.
22 . The apparatus according to claim 20 , wherein said sensing detects physical layer cell identities of nearby cells which use the same radio access technology.
23 . The apparatus according to claim 19 , wherein said apparatus is adapted to use a previous cell configuration profile stored in said apparatus if said sensing does not indicate any notable change in said local radio environment.
24 . The apparatus according to claim 19 , wherein said apparatus is adapted to broadcast a neighborhood status information.

39 . The apparatus according to claim 19 , wherein said assigned local cell spectrum resource entity or profile includes a semi-static part that is exclusive to the access device and a dynamic shareable part to enable allocation of cell spectrum resource to said access device depending on the local radio environment operable to establish implicit coordination between local cells of the cellular network based on the local radio environment, and to allocate cell spectrum resource from a shared multi-operator spectrum to said access device based on both the semi-static part and the dynamic shareable part, wherein the local cell spectrum resource entity or profile is selected from a limited set of predefined basic cell spectrum resource entities or profiles provided for cell configuration of the cellular network, and the semi-static part accommodates semi-static instances of common and control channels specific to a local access point and the dynamic shareable part is adapted to allocate the available system bandwidth or spectrum resources seen by the local access point.
